Gamification in Online Learning: 8 Strategies to Boost Engagement and Learning Outcomes.

Gamification uses game-based elements such as points, badges, leaderboards, challenges, and rewards to motivate and engage learners. It is known to help learners assimilate new information, test their knowledge, develop skills, and have fun. Gamification has become a popular method for engaging students and improving learning outcomes in online courses. By incorporating games into course outlines, edupreneurs can create an interactive, dynamic learning environment that motivates learners. Defining Clear Learning Objective

Defining a clear learning objective is the first step in integrating gamification in online courses. This will also serve as a roadmap for edupreneurs by helping them to identify which gaming elements to use and how to apply them effectively. The learning objective should be specific, measurable, achievable, relevant, and time conscious of marking progress.

For different learning objectives, edupreneurs should consider the overall goals of the course and know the skills and knowledge that learners will gain. Most of the time, this involves breaking down larger goals into smaller and manageable objectives. Also, be aware and identify specific behaviors and actions that learners should be able to demonstrate to show that they have achieved the course\’s objectives.

By defining clear course objectives, edupreneurs can better align gamification with different course content and ensure that the gaming elements are designed to support the desired learning objectives.

Creating a Narrative

Creating a narrative or a story is another effective strategy for integrating gamification into student courses. Educators can engage learners and provide informative content for learning materials. This is done by incorporating a record or a report into the course. A good narrative should be simple or as complex as desired. It should also be relevant, merge with the course content, and align with the learning objectives. For example, edupreneurs can create a game where the learners must complete a series of challenges to save planet earth from an impending disaster. This type of narrative will provide learners with a clear goal and a sense of purpose, which will keep them engaged and motivated as they learn.

When creating a narrative or a story, it is essential to consider different learners\’ needs and learning styles. The narrative should not only be engaging and accessible, but it should also be appropriate for the learner\’s age, experience level, and cultural background. Additionally, the narrative should be seamlessly and naturally integrated into the course design. Incorporating a narrative or story into gamification in online learning courses can create a more immersive and engaging learning experience for learners.

Incorporating Points, badges, and Leader Boards

This is another effective way to integrate gamification into online learning today. The gaming element provides the learners with a sense of achievement and progress, which will help motivate and keep them engaged with the material they are learning.

Points can be used as rewards for completing various activities or achieving specific milestones in the course. Badges can be used as awards for achieving mastery or expertise in a particular area or subject. Leader\’s boards can be used to display the progress of learners in comparison to their peers. They can also show display the awards and rewards that each student has achieved. This will encourage healthy completion and motivate learners to strive for excellence.

However, when incorporating points, badges, and leaderboards, it is essential to ensure they align with the course\’s learning objectives. The points, badges, and leaderboards should be tailored to reinforce a desired behavior or action. But they should also keep the learners from the main objective and content of the course. Additionally, all learners should receive clear feedback on earning points and badges to ensure that leaderboards are transparent and fair.

Providing Immediate Feedback

This is another fundamental reason why edupreneurs are incorporating gamification into online classes. Feedback can be provided in a variety of ways. This may include points, badges, leaderboards, and other traditional methods like quizzes and assessments. Immediate feedback helps learners track their progress and identify areas to focus on and improve. Feedback also reinforces positive behaviors and actions, and this helps in motivating learners to continue engaging with the course content. Learners and educators can stay on track and progress toward achieving the course objectives by providing frequent and consistent feedback.

However, when providing feedback, it is essential to be clear and specific. Feedback should focus on the behavior and the action being learned and tested. It should also be actionable and open to improvements through suggestions. Additionally, feedback should be provided promptly. Giving feedback is essential in gamification as it helps reinforce behavior, support learning objectives, and motivate learners.

Incorporating Challenges and Opportunities

Incorporating problem-solving opportunities is another effective way to integrate gamification into an online course. Challenges provide learners with the best options to apply their knowledge and skills in real-world scenarios, reinforcing learning and improving retention.

Challenges can be structured in many forms, including case studies, simulations, and role-playing exercises. The challenges can be individual or collaborative, depending on the course objective. By providing learners with opportunities to solve problems and apply their knowledge, edupreneurs can help learners to develop critical thinking and problem-solving skills which is the primary objective of any course.

However, the challenges should not be frustrating and impossible as they will frustrate learners. Nevertheless, incorporating challenges and opportunities for problem-solving into an online course is an effective way to integrate gamification in online learning without altering the course objective.

Personalization

This is another effective strategy for integrating gamification into online courses. Personalization is making tailored course content and activities to individual needs and preferences. This will help the needs of individual learners as different people learn and understand differently.

Personalization can be in the form of offering learners a choice in the activities they choose to complete and providing customized feedback based on their progress in the given topic. An educator can come up with a game in which learners select their avatar or character, or they can allow learners to determine which topics or modules they want to focus on based on their interests and knowledge.

However, it is crucial to ensure that the using gamification in online learning aligns with the desired course outcome when incorporating personalization. The goal should be to help learners achieve their objectives rather than simply providing an entertaining platform. Additionally, personalization should be flexible and adaptable, allowing learners to customize their preferences and choices as they progress through the course.

Incorporating personalization into an online course is an effective way to integrate gamification and support learning outcomes. By tailoring the course content and activities to each learner\’s needs and preferences, educators can improve engagement and motivation, contributing to the overall course success.

Social Interaction and Collaboration

These are effective ways to integrate gamification into an online course. Social interaction can foster a sense of community among learners, increasing engagement and learning motivation. Social interaction and collaboration can take many forms. This can include discussion forums, peer review activities, and group projects. By encouraging learners to interact with each other and collaborate on different course activities, edupreneurs can help create a supportive learning environment and improve the overall learning outcome.

But, when incorporating social interaction and interaction, it is vital to provide clear guidelines and expectations for the participants. Edupreneurs should provide opportunities for the learner to give feedback to each other as they reflect on learning and progress. Additionally, it is essential to ensure that learners respect and support each other and are held accountable for their actions.

Incorporating social interaction and collaboration into a course is one of the most effective ways of integrating gamification in online learning and studies. Educators can improve engagement, motivation, and overall course success by creating a community among learners.

Storytelling

Incorporating storytelling can also be an effective way to blend gamification into online courses. Storytelling has numerous benefits, such as helping create a compelling, immersive learning experience to increase motivation and engagement. Storytelling can take many forms, such as case studies, role-playing exercises, and scenarios that simulate real-world situations. By presenting information in a story format, edupreneurs can help learners understand and remember learned content clearly. Additionally, storytelling can help learners develop empathy and connect with the material they are learning personally.

However, when incorporating storytelling, it is essential to ensure that the story is well crafted and aligns with the learning objective of the course.
